Intermediate bulk container (ibc) and associated pallet
Abstract
An intermediate bulk container system includes a molded bottle and a pallet. The molded bottle includes a bottom wall and a top wall opposite the bottom wall. A plurality of support columns extend vertically from the bottom wall and define a column thickness. A plurality of sidewalls extending vertically between the bottom wall and the top wall and horizontally between the support columns. The sidewalls define a sidewall thickness that is less than the column thickness. The molded bottle further includes a band or belt that wraps around the molded bottle, and the band is formed of a plurality of ribs. Each of the plurality of ribs protrudes outward from one of the plurality of sidewalls and extends between a pair of the plurality of columns, wherein each of the plurality of ribs defines a rib thickness that is less than the column thickness.
